Output 37b59a29f9cbe881aab2d7b81c00e60c40cd30fd45b0985fb0bef5e53bc44f8e:1

value
22126360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cff44d5ebc3850e8c2719c549f3774476093d715 OP_EQUAL
address
3LeaTfkbouTJpZ99Hffkk3LxL5pNser8Ai
transaction
37b59a29f9cbe881aab2d7b81c00e60c40cd30fd45b0985fb0bef5e53bc44f8e
spent
true